Step 1: Utilize eBay’s Default Search
One of the simplest ways to find sold items on eBay is by using eBay’s default search functionality. Start by entering relevant keywords describing the item you are interested in finding. This can be as specific or general as you need it to be, depending on what you are looking for.
Step 2: Filter Your Search Results
After entering your keywords, scroll down the menu on the left side of the search results page. Look for the “Show only” section and check the box next to “Sold items.” This action will refine your search results to show only items that have been sold on eBay within the past 90 days.
Step 3: Analyze the Sold Items List
Once you have selected the sold items filter, you will be presented with a list of items that have been sold recently on eBay. Take your time to browse through the listings and analyze the prices at which these items have sold. This information can be valuable for determining market value or setting prices for your own items.
Benefits of Viewing Sold Items on eBay
There are several benefits to viewing sold items on eBay. By analyzing the prices at which similar items have sold, you can gain valuable insights into pricing trends and market demand. This information can be particularly useful for sellers looking to set competitive prices or buyers seeking to make informed purchasing decisions.
Market Research and Pricing
For sellers, viewing sold items on eBay can help you conduct market research and gain a better understanding of what prices items are selling for. This data can inform your pricing strategy and help you set prices that are in line with market trends, ultimately increasing your chances of making successful sales.
Valuing Collectibles and Antiques
If you are a collector or enthusiast of antiques and collectibles, viewing sold items on eBay can be a valuable resource for valuing items in your collection. By seeing the prices at which similar items have sold, you can get a sense of the market value and demand for your collectibles.
Tracking Product Availability
By regularly checking sold items on eBay, you can also track the availability of specific products and how quickly they are selling. This information can be helpful for sellers looking to stock popular items or buyers trying to gauge the availability of a particular product.
